EXCEEDS logo
Exceeds
daslu

PROFILE

Daslu

Daniel Slutsky developed and maintained the scicloj/noj repository, delivering a robust suite of data science tutorials and tooling in Clojure. Over nine months, he engineered features such as advanced table processing, visualization modules, and machine learning tutorials, emphasizing reproducibility and maintainability. His technical approach combined dependency management, build automation, and documentation refinement, ensuring stable releases and streamlined onboarding. Daniel utilized Clojure, YAML, and Dockerfile to integrate data pipelines, automate builds, and enhance content delivery. His work demonstrated depth through iterative refactoring, code quality improvements, and the introduction of web-based data ingestion, resulting in a reliable, user-focused learning platform.

Overall Statistics

Feature vs Bugs

75%Features

Repository Contributions

219Total
Bugs
25
Commits
219
Features
77
Lines of code
113,330
Activity Months9

Work History

June 2025

1 Commits • 1 Features

Jun 1, 2025

In June 2025, delivered targeted enhancements to the Plotly Tutorial in the scicloj/noj repository to improve code readability and maintainability. The changes focus on Clojure map literals by converting string keys to keywords and removing an unnecessary trailing comma, reducing potential confusion and future issues. This work aligns with our goals of clearer tutorials and easier contribution onboarding.

May 2025

5 Commits • 2 Features

May 1, 2025

May 2025 monthly summary for scicloj/noj: Delivered user-facing enhancements and stability improvements through feature delivery, targeted bug fixes, and release engineering to support clearer upgrade paths and maintainability.

April 2025

15 Commits • 3 Features

Apr 1, 2025

April 2025 monthly summary for scicloj/noj focused on stability, maintainability, and release discipline. Delivered comprehensive documentation and code quality improvements, aligned dependencies with Clay upgrades, and standardized release versioning. This groundwork enhances onboarding, reduces support friction, and enables faster, more reliable future iterations. No new customer-facing features this month, but the technical foundations significantly reduce risk in release cycles and future feature delivery.

March 2025

30 Commits • 8 Features

Mar 1, 2025

March 2025 performance summary for scicloj/noj: A focused dependency and release engineering sprint that modernized the stack, improved observability, and tightened release governance. Delivered logging enabled via SLF4J, CLI stability through Clay updates, and broader data tooling readiness via core tooling integrations. Implemented systematic versioning across methamorph beta releases, refreshed documentation, and stabilized the product by addressing key regressions and CDN-related issues. This sprint sets the foundation for reliable deployments and faster feature delivery in the upcoming quarter.

February 2025

26 Commits • 14 Features

Feb 1, 2025

In February 2025, scicloj/noj delivered substantial feature enhancements, dependency hygiene, and data ingestion improvements, setting the stage for the 2-beta7 release. The work strengthened documentation, code quality, and release readiness while upgrading key data pipelines to fetch assets from the web, increasing reliability for dashboards and demos. Packaging and versioning improvements, including Uberjar packaging and Clay integration, reduced deployment risk and improved reproducibility across environments.

January 2025

36 Commits • 14 Features

Jan 1, 2025

January 2025 (noj repo) delivered a strong mix of feature delivery, documentation polish, and stability work that improves value for users and reduces maintenance risk. The work focused on visualization, data-processing readiness, and dependable release tooling, enabling faster experimentation and onboarding while preserving quality.

December 2024

53 Commits • 17 Features

Dec 1, 2024

December 2024 monthly summary for the noj repository (scicloj/noj). The month delivered production-ready feature work, stability enhancements, and a clear path to the upcoming release while expanding the book and tutorials to improve user value and learning curves. Key business outcomes include faster, more reliable releases, reduced data footprint, and higher-quality documentation and examples.

November 2024

46 Commits • 16 Features

Nov 1, 2024

November 2024 monthly summary for scicloj/noj: Stabilized and modernized the codebase while laying groundwork for upcoming features. Key features delivered include extensive dependency and library upgrades across the ecosystem (test deps updated, clojure.java-time added; general bumps across Kindly, Hanami, Tableplot, Kind-pyplot, SCI; underlying_libraries refreshed; Metamorph.ml, scicloj.ml.xgboost, Tableplot updated), and release version bumps for the 2-alpha series (2-alpha10.1, 2-alpha11, 2-alpha12). Visualization and data science work advanced with Chicago-bike-times plotting improvements (WIP) using clojure.java-time for truncation and reorganized plots, and foundational work on fastmath_vector_geom2d3d (2D/3D geometry). Added Word2Vec examples data and Word Embeddings tutorial drafts to support NLP workflows. Documentation improvements included README updates, wording refinements, updated chapters, and a CHANGELOG entry for 2024-11, culminating in publishing the Echarts tutorial from draft. Core table processing (tablecloth_table_processing) progressed via WIP development, new printing and column-adding examples, and a group-by/aggregation example, complemented by a missing require fix and general cleanup.

October 2024

7 Commits • 2 Features

Oct 1, 2024

October 2024 monthly summary for scicloj/noj: Delivered a new Linear Algebra Tutorial and consolidated dependency management and documentation updates, improving learning resources, build stability, and readiness for upcoming releases.

Activity

Loading activity data...

Quality Metrics

Correctness95.6%
Maintainability96.0%
Architecture94.8%
Performance93.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

CSVClojureDataDockerfileEDNMarkdownYAML

Technical Skills

API IntegrationBuild AutomationBuild ManagementCI/CDCLI ToolsChangelog ManagementClojureClojure DevelopmentCode CleanupCode CommentingCode CorrectionCode FormattingCode OrganizationCode RefactoringConfiguration

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

scicloj/noj

Oct 2024 Jun 2025
9 Months active

Languages Used

ClojureMarkdownDataEDNCSVDockerfileYAML

Technical Skills

Build ManagementClojureData ScienceDependency ManagementDocumentationLinear Algebra

Generated by Exceeds AIThis report is designed for sharing and indexing